科技日报记者 马爱平
几百家便利店该怎样样选址,才干掩盖尽或许多的人口?
几百个物流机器人的行进道路该怎样实时规划,才干功率最高又不发作磕碰?
在打车体系中当乘客宣布要车恳求,把这位乘客分配给哪个司机,是挑选区域最优,分配给离得最近的实践,仍是仍是做到动态最优?
在已知未来几个小时,会有一场演唱会完毕,可以预见演唱会周围的区域的用车需求会添加,那么现在的这个搭车恳求,在整个城市范围内怎样经过决议方案完成一个均衡状况,让所有人的满意度尽或许地最大化?
……
这样一些问题的处理或许需求一个大的动态规划体系来建模,而最终的求解,往往需求近似求解一个线性整数规划来迫临。求解器就供给了这样的一个核算体系。
而问题求解规划越大,就越依托求解器,因而物流交通、电网、航空、金融等职业中有许多中心算法更高度依托求解器这一奥秘“黑匣子”。
日前,我国自主研制的杉数数学线性规划求解器在闻名第三方测评网站亚利桑那大学米特尔曼教授的测验集上位列第一,成为我国第一个自主研制的商业等级求解器,我国求解器的测验速度跻身国际顶尖商业求解器之列。
运用COPT求解器的命令行东西求解问题 图片由作者供给
求解器像是运筹学里的“芯片”
什么是求解器?
在2018年平昌冬奥会的闭幕式上,我国接棒八分钟展现里呈现的无人仓机器人,科技感十足,冷艳了全国际。
怎样核算这些机器人的运转道路,保证这些机器人不会彼此“撞车”,一起又最有功率,要处理这样一些问题,需求一个最优算法,依托的便是求解器。
“在运筹学里,关于数学规划求解器的界说是,针对多种现已树立的线性、整数及各种非线性规划模型,进行算法优化的求解器,可以看作一个‘黑盒子’软件体系。”我国运筹学会理事长、研讨员胡旭东告知科技日报记者,求解器就像是运筹学里的“芯片”,绝大多数杂乱体系的决议方案问题都需求用到数学规划求解器,来寻求最优化的处理方案。
“求解器就好比是电脑的操作体系,处理不同问题的数学模型便是一个个软件。一个求解器可以衍生出许多笔直的场景,虽然这些场景看上去不同很大,但本质上相通。救护车调度、航班规划、库存优化,这些从数据到决议方案的转化工作,都可经过运筹学模型与机器学习将实践问题转化为数学模型求解。”胡旭东说。
可是,在曩昔三十余年中,这种高精度求解器高度依托进口。
胡旭东表明,而关于各大企业而言,购买商业求解器的最大问题在于价格昂扬且无法做针对性调整。
“以国家发展为例,基础设施建设中的电网、水利体系、铁路、高速公路建设等一系列问题都涉及到相似的大规划优化算法问题,运用国际上老练的闭源商业求解器就从另一方面代表着难以做出针对性改进,得到最优成果。此外,军事上的战略资源调度、航空范畴的战略部署等关乎国家安全问题,也对自主知识产权的软件有着底子性需求。”胡旭东说。
跻身国际顶尖商业求解器之列
“不管从何种视点,这样的软件,国内有必要得有自己的中心技能知识堆集。”胡旭东说。
怎样在短短数年间跻身国际顶尖商业求解器之列?
胡旭东说,求解器在技能层面要求十分高,将一个数学上高度杂乱的体系,以百万行等级的代码工程化地完成出来,是国外求解器根本上走了三十年的求索之路。
核算速度的每一点提高都需求很多的考虑和测验,把真实决议速度差异的“坑”一个一个发掘出来,调集了这个范畴最尖端的华人,用了三年的时刻,杉数科技自主研制成功国内首个商业求解器渠道——“杉数数学规划求解器”。
除了时刻投入外,人才也成为限制求解器国产化的要素。杉数科技创始人葛冬冬以为,开发求解器需求的人才具有三个特色。
第一是数学功底好,优化算法功底厚实,第二是代码才能强,有体系工程开发才能。第三是最好具有求解器开发经历。
“高校培育的同学,或许最大的问题是学生处理问题的才能可以多方统筹的不太多,求解器里边有哪些坑,他们不知道。而国内企业培育人才又有点急于求成,等不起一个人才渐渐老练。”葛冬冬说。
火急的需求,使求解器的落地使用速度加速。
超大工厂的排产排程问题,往往会面临着巨大的体系之间出产资源和产能的分配和协调,零部件会大到数万种,车间几百个,出产规划又会需求对未来数周精确到小时等级做规划。“咱们协助国内最大的电子通讯设备厂、轿车类企业等都做过相似的工作。”葛冬冬说。
永辉在上海现在现已有300多家店。此前,他们与杉数协作,用选址软件来做智能选址。
“比方,本年方案开50家,下一年开100家,后年开150家,使用求解器就就可以算出这50家该怎样开,下一年100家怎样开,相互之间不会发生恶性竞争。这就需求求解器把这300家门店做大局优化,做一个线性整合规划体系,然后用软件去算,最终算出来就比较接近于大局优化,而不是仅仅一个部分的东西。”葛冬冬说。
胡旭东说,电网中的机组组合优化、调度优化、无功优化、现货商场的核算,中心算法都需求求解器来驱动。再比方,航空中机组的日常排班,紧迫情况下航班的调整和从头规划,物流中,送货道路和车辆的的调度和规划、多职业中服务人员的日常道路规划等,都是求解器能发挥及其重要的效果的范畴。
“求解器国产化的另一个原因是,国产化后,国内的企业可以精确的经过本身的问题进行定制化规划。因为不了解国外求解器体系,此前许多企业遇到许多特定问题时,常常得不到最好的答案,‘黑匣子’永远是关闭的,乃至不知道数据的传输是否安全。国产化求解器,就可以精确的经过企业的特别问题,进行定制化调整。”胡旭东说。
“国外研讨求解器现已有30多年前史,咱们才刚刚起步。而咱们线性、整数规划,非线性规划求解器根本成型,现在已有三十多项知识产权,方案一两年后到达百项。”葛冬冬说。
“本年,国际闻名求解器公测渠道米特尔曼的测验网页显现,我国杉数科技的线性规划求解器占有了第一的方位,其速度现已比第二名快了40%多。”胡旭东说,由美国亚利桑那州立大学汉斯·米特尔曼教授所保护的这一测验网站,供给了多个商业和开源的数学规划求解器的测评数据。这一测评成为了解和挑选求解器的窗口,也被求解器业界奉为软件功能排名的事实标准。
来历:科技日报 文中图片除标示外来自网络
修改:刘义阳
审阅:管晶晶